Understanding Wordle and Why It's So Addictive

Before we get into the specifics of today's puzzle, let's quickly recap what makes Wordle so captivating. This simple yet challenging word game gives you six attempts to guess a five-letter word. After each guess, the game provides feedback by coloring the letters:

  • Green: The letter is correct and in the correct position.
  • Yellow: The letter is correct but in the wrong position.
  • Gray: The letter is not in the word at all.

Strategies to Master Wordle: Your Arsenal of Tactics

To consistently conquer Wordle, it's essential to have a few key strategies in your arsenal. These tactics will help you make the most of your six guesses and narrow down the possibilities efficiently.

1. The Power of the Starting Word

Your first guess is crucial. A well-chosen starting word can reveal several common letters, giving you a significant head start. Many players swear by words that contain a mix of vowels and frequently used consonants, such as "AUDIO," "TEARS," or "OUIJA." The goal is to uncover as many green or yellow letters as possible to guide your subsequent guesses. Experiment with different starting words to see what works best for you. Some people prefer to stick to the same word every time, while others like to switch it up to keep things interesting. The key is to find a word that provides a solid foundation for your word-solving journey.

2. Vowel Power: Unlocking the Mystery

Vowels are the building blocks of most words, so identifying them early on is vital. After your initial guess, focus on incorporating different vowels into your next attempts. If you haven't found any green or yellow vowels yet, try words like "ADIEU" or "ABOUT" to cover multiple vowels at once. Once you've identified the vowels in the word, you can start focusing on the consonants.

3. Common Consonants: The Next Piece of the Puzzle

After vowels, focus on common consonants like "S," "T," "R," "N," and "L." These letters appear frequently in English words, so they're a good bet for your next guesses. Try to arrange these consonants in different positions to see if you can get any green or yellow results. Remember, the goal is to gather as much information as possible with each guess.

4. Eliminating Letters: The Art of Deduction

Wordle is as much about eliminating incorrect letters as it is about finding the correct ones. Pay close attention to the gray letters – these letters are not in the word. Avoid using them in your subsequent guesses. This process of elimination will help you narrow down the possibilities and focus on the letters that are most likely to be in the word.

5. Pattern Recognition: Spotting Word Structures

As you get more familiar with Wordle, you'll start to recognize common word patterns. For example, words ending in "-ATE," "-ING," or "-ED" are quite frequent. Similarly, words with double letters (like "LL" or "SS") are also common. Keeping these patterns in mind can help you make more informed guesses.
